The Emergence of Secure and Efficient Withdrawal Systems
With the ongoing integration of e-commerce and brick-and-mortar stores, understanding how consumers can effectively withdraw or access their funds at dispensaries is crucial. Historically, many cannabis retailers relied on traditional cash transactions, which posed safety and logistical challenges. Today, digital payment solutions, such as secure e-wallets and banking transfer options, are increasingly prevalent.
However, in jurisdictions like Canada, strict banking regulations and federal oversight have limited the scope of conventional financial services extended to cannabis businesses. This regulatory environment necessitates alternative methods for consumer withdrawals and payouts, often facilitated via specialized dispensary platforms and compliant financial service providers.
